Batman v Superman is one oft the worst movies DC has ever created, if not the worst. The story is absolutely not comprehensible, there's too much happening at the same time. The "story" also makes absolutely no sense and basically every character is created just bad.
Lex Luthor, for example, is just a kid, who got a firm from his Dad and just doesn't know what to do with all that power.
Batman ist too violent and goes against all of his values, which, I'll give you that, fits to the version of Bruce Wayne we see in that movie, which is a much older version, who has been through a lot. So it maybe fits the character, but it still is version of Batman, who isn't very likeable.
With Superman on the other hand we see, what I would consider the best character of the movie. He is a good man, maybe even the best man you could find, but that also makes him look a lot more weak.
And then there's the obvious reason, what makes the movie completely stupid: MARTHA?! I mean what in the actual a** were they thinking?
